| General Information | |
|---|---|
| Part Number | CNGE2FE4SMSPoEHO |
| Condition | Refurbished |
| Technical Information | |
|---|---|
| Switch Type | Managed Switch |
| Form Factor | Compact |
| Mount Type | Desktop |
| Switch Ports | 6 x 1000Base-TX (Gigabit RJ-45) |
| Number of Ports | 6-Ports |
| Port Type | RJ-45, SFP |
| Port Speed | Copper: 10/100 Mbps; Optical: 1000 Mbps full duplex, also supports 100 Mbps |
| POE Support | PoE+ |
| VLAN Support | Yes |
| Layer Support | Layer 2 |
| Connector Type | RJ‑45 (Ports 1–4), SFP slots (Ports 5–6), terminal block for power |
| Management and Configuration | |
|---|---|
| Remote Protocols | Yes |
| Security Features | IEEE 802.3at compliance; voltage transient protection; automatic MDI/MDI‑X |
| Power & Cooling | |
|---|---|
| Power | PoE |
| Physical Characteristics | |
|---|---|
| Dimensions | 1.1″ × 6.1″ × 5.3" |
| Weight | 4.00 |
